Output 71e3c82f40c8e9870113cfa4359d398098247ca504f12efc64606cc62feb911f:18

value
1659116
script pubkey
OP_0 OP_PUSHBYTES_20 3fc45e910146c2aec70b6c045cd4568fab132feb
address
bc1q8lz9aygpgmp2a3ctdsz9e4zk3743xtltt99dym
transaction
71e3c82f40c8e9870113cfa4359d398098247ca504f12efc64606cc62feb911f
spent
true